Grand Rapids, MI Moving Costs 2026
Grand Rapids is one of the Midwest's more affordable metros for local moves, a competitive West Michigan mover market and mostly suburban housing with driveway access keep crew hours and hourly rates below the national average.
Typical local move, 2-bedroom home
$825–$1,225
2-mover crew
$118/hr
3-mover crew
$177/hr
4-mover crew
$236/hr
Truck included · how we calculate
Grand Rapids hourly moving rates
| Crew size | Rate / hour | Typical for |
|---|---|---|
| 2 movers | $118 | Studio – 1BR |
| 3 movers | $177 | 2BR – 3BR |
| 4 movers | $236 | 4BR+ |
Local move cost by home size
| Home size | Low | Typical | High |
|---|---|---|---|
| Studio | $300 | $375 | $475 |
| 1 Bedroom | $425 | $525 | $650 |
| 2 Bedroom | $825 | $1,025 | $1,225 |
| 3 Bedroom | $1,150 | $1,400 | $1,700 |
| 4 Bedroom | $1,825 | $2,225 | $2,725 |
| 5+ Bedroom | $2,225 | $2,725 | $3,325 |
What makes Grand Rapids cost less
A local move is crew hours, so the question is always what the housing here does to those hours. Most West Michigan housing offers driveway or garage access, which keeps crews close to the door. The older homes in Heritage Hill and Eastown add porch steps, full basements, and narrow stairwells to the job.
Net of all that, Grand Rapids prices 5% below the national average. The same 2-bedroom local move that typically costs $1,075 nationally runs $1,025 in Grand Rapids, a difference of $50 less.
Who is moving in Grand Rapids, and when
Demand comes from West Michigan's manufacturing, furniture, and healthcare employers, plus a steady flow of households relocating in from Chicago and Detroit for lower housing costs.
The short West Michigan summer concentrates demand from June through early September, and the late-August university move-in weeks are the tightest of the year.
Moving from Grand Rapids to nearby metros
The closest markets we publish rates for, with the real road distance from Grand Rapids and what a 3-bedroom household costs over exactly that distance. Anything under about 50 miles is still priced as a local, hourly job; past that, per-mile transport starts stacking on top of the crew hours.
| Corridor | Distance | Typical | Range |
|---|---|---|---|
| Grand Rapids to Ann Arbor, MI | 128 mi | $2,100 | $1,725–$2,550 |
| Grand Rapids to Milwaukee, WI | 134 mi | $2,125 | $1,750–$2,600 |
| Grand Rapids to Chicago, IL | 147 mi | $2,175 | $1,775–$2,650 |
| Grand Rapids to Detroit, MI | 165 mi | $2,250 | $1,850–$2,750 |
